<delete> is used:
A response to <delete> should be a <status> indicating whether or not the <delete> was processed successfully.
<delete class-name="User" src-dn="\Sam">
<association>1012</association>
</delete>
- association
- Unique key of the application object.
- operation-data
- Operation additional custom data.
Attribute Value(s) Default Value cached-time CDATA
The time the event was placed into the driver cache. The format is CCYYMMDDhhmmss.mmmZ, always in UTC.#IMPLIED class-name CDATA
The name of the base class of the object.
The class name is mapped between the application and eDirectory name spaces by the schema mapping rule so that DirXML will see the name in the eDirectory namespace and a driver will see the name in the application name space.#IMPLIED dest-dn CDATA
The distinguished name of the target object in the namespace of the receiver.
Should be left empty for event notifications.#IMPLIED dest-entry-id CDATA
The entry id of the target object in the namespace of the receiver.
Should be left empty for event notifications.#IMPLIED event-id CDATA
An identifier used to tag the results of an event or command.#IMPLIED qualified-src-dn CDATA
The qualified version of src-dn. Only used for describing objects from eDirectory.#IMPLIED src-dn CDATA
The distinguished name of source object that generated the event in the namespace of the sender.#IMPLIED src-entry-id CDATA
The entry id of source object that generated the event in the namespace of the sender.
(Reserved) Should be ignored by the driver.#IMPLIED timestamp CDATA
